Abstract

Pulmonary hypoplasia is a rare congenital disorder. Respiratory and circulatory systems sustain a closely correlated function, and if the function of one is impaired, the other will inescapably be affected. We presented a unilateral lung hypoplasia case that manifested a cardiological disorder (ventricular arrhythmia) rather than a respiratory-related symptom. We highly recommend that such patients should be followed-up by a cardiologist beside a pulmonologist.
